GKD订阅管理:从碎片化到系统化的智能解决方案
GKD订阅管理从碎片化到系统化的智能解决方案【免费下载链接】GKD_THS_ListGKD第三方订阅收录名单项目地址: https://gitcode.com/gh_mirrors/gk/GKD_THS_List在GKD生态中订阅管理长期困扰着进阶用户。面对分散的订阅源、不透明的维护状态、以及网络访问的复杂性如何构建一个可持续的订阅体系成为技术爱好者的核心痛点。GKD_THS_List项目通过系统化整合与自动化验证为这一问题提供了工程级解决方案将订阅管理从手动维护升级为智能运维。 核心理念订阅生态的系统化治理订阅管理的本质是资源发现与质量控制的双重挑战。传统方法依赖社区推荐和个人试错而GKD_THS_List采用数据驱动的方式重构了这一流程订阅不是孤立的链接集合而是一个需要持续监控和评估的动态系统。项目的核心价值在于将碎片化的订阅信息转化为结构化数据。通过scripts/types.ts定义的标准接口每个订阅源被建模为包含ID、作者、维护状态、更新策略等维度的数据实体。这种设计使得订阅评估从主观判断转向客观指标分析。订阅质量的评估框架基于三个核心维度活跃度指标基于GitHub提交频率的维护状态判定可用性验证多源链接的冗余设计与网络适配标识唯一性通过ID系统避免订阅冲突⚡ 实践路径构建可持续的订阅工作流快速部署与初始化配置项目采用TypeScript构建确保类型安全与开发体验的一致性。初始化流程极其简单git clone https://gitcode.com/gh_mirrors/gk/GKD_THS_List cd GKD_THS_List pnpm install核心数据结构体现在list.ts文件中该文件作为订阅的总入口包含了所有经过验证的订阅源信息。每个订阅条目都遵循统一的schema{ name: 订阅名称, id: 86, // 唯一标识符 prescribedUpdateUrl: false, // 更新策略 active: true, // 维护状态 subUrls: [...] // 多源链接 }订阅源筛选与网络优化策略面对国内复杂的网络环境项目特别设计了多源适配机制。每个订阅提供至少两种链接源GitHub源用于国际网络npmmirror或gitmirror源用于国内直连。这种设计确保了订阅的全球可用性。订阅源类型访问速度稳定性适用场景GitHub源中等高国际网络环境npmmirror源快速中等国内直连gitmirror源快速中等国内开发者jsDelivr源快速高CDN加速自动化维护状态监控项目的自动化检查机制通过scripts/check.ts实现定期订阅状态验证。脚本会分析每个订阅源的GitHub活动记录自动标记超过30天无更新的订阅为停止维护状态。这种主动监控机制消除了手动检查的负担。 进阶应用订阅管理的工程化实践自定义订阅集成与贡献流程对于希望贡献新订阅源的开发者项目提供了标准化的贡献流程。通过CONTRIBUTING.md文档贡献者可以了解如何准备符合格式要求的订阅数据提交Pull Request进行代码审查通过自动化测试确保数据完整性订阅数据的更新通过scripts/update.ts脚本实现该脚本负责从原始仓库拉取最新信息并更新本地数据库。这种设计确保了订阅信息的时效性。订阅质量的多维度评估进阶用户可以通过订阅的元数据进行深度分析维护活跃度基于提交频率的量化评分规则覆盖率订阅包含的规则数量与类型分布更新策略prescribedUpdateUrl标志的智能选择网络冗余度可用链接源的数量与地理分布企业级部署的最佳实践对于需要大规模部署GKD订阅的组织项目提供了以下建议镜像同步建立内部订阅镜像避免外部依赖质量阈值设置订阅活跃度的最低标准故障转移配置多源订阅的自动切换机制审计日志记录订阅变更与使用情况 技术实现深度解析订阅标识系统的设计哲学GKD_THS_List采用数字ID作为订阅的唯一标识符这种设计避免了命名冲突问题。ID分配遵循先到先得原则确保了系统的向后兼容性。当用户尝试导入相同ID的订阅时GKD客户端会自动提示冲突避免了配置混乱。多源链接的智能选择算法项目的核心优势在于网络适应性。每个订阅的subUrls数组包含多个链接源用户可以根据自身网络环境选择最优路径。对于国内用户推荐使用标注国内的链接源这些源通常部署在国内CDN上访问速度更快。状态同步与数据一致性保证通过scripts/writeFile.ts脚本项目确保了数据文件的一致性。该脚本将内存中的订阅数据序列化为标准格式并写入到list.ts文件中。这种设计使得数据更新过程可追溯、可回滚。 订阅生态的健康度指标健康的订阅生态需要持续的监控与维护。GKD_THS_List项目通过以下指标评估订阅生态的健康度活跃订阅比例当前仍在维护的订阅占总数的百分比更新频率分布各订阅的规则更新间隔统计网络可用性各链接源的成功率与响应时间用户采纳率基于社区反馈的订阅质量评估这些指标不仅帮助用户选择优质订阅也为订阅作者提供了改进方向。通过数据驱动的反馈循环整个GKD订阅生态得以持续优化。 未来演进方向随着GKD生态的不断发展订阅管理系统也需要持续演进。未来的改进方向包括智能推荐系统基于用户使用习惯的个性化订阅推荐质量评分体系建立多维度的订阅质量评分标准自动化测试框架订阅规则的自动化验证与兼容性测试社区治理机制建立订阅源的社区评审与准入流程GKD_THS_List项目为GKD订阅管理提供了从理论到实践的完整解决方案。通过系统化思维和工程化方法它将订阅管理从繁琐的手工操作转变为高效的自动化流程为GKD生态的健康发展奠定了坚实基础。【免费下载链接】GKD_THS_ListGKD第三方订阅收录名单项目地址: https://gitcode.com/gh_mirrors/gk/GKD_THS_List创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考